Funplay MCP for Unity is an MIT-licensed Unity Editor MCP server that lets AI assistants like Claude Code, Cursor, LM Studio, Windsurf, Codex, and VS Code Copilot operate directly inside your running Unity project.
Describe your game in one sentence โ your AI assistant builds it in Unity through Funplay MCP for Unity's 156 built-in tools for scene creation, script generation, runtime validation, input simulation, performance analysis, and editor automation.

Menu: Funplay โ MCP Server to start the server.
A new project gets its own port, derived from the project path, so two editors opened on different projects never fight over one port. The MCP Server window shows the exact URL (http://127.0.0.1:<port>/); the one-click configuration writes that URL for you. Type a port in Server Port to pin a fixed one (CI, a firewall rule) and Use Per-Project Port to derive one instead.
Upgrading from an earlier version changes nothing: the project keeps the port it was already using, recorded as a pin, so existing client configs keep working. Click Use Per-Project Port when you want that project to run beside another editor. See Running Several Unity Projects at Once for the full setup guide.
If the window reports a fallback port, do not use a client entry that still targets the occupied stable port; it could reach the process that owns that port. One-click configuration stays blocked until you click Use Per-Project Port or Pin Current Port and the server finishes restarting.
Direct in-process HTTP is the default transport. If you need stronger connection continuity across Unity script recompiles or Play Mode domain reloads, enable Experimental Broker Mode in the MCP Server window. It runs a tiny local broker with Unity's bundled Mono, keeps the same 127.0.0.1 port for MCP clients, and requires no client config change.

Use the built-in One-Click MCP Configuration in the Funplay > MCP Server window first.
Select your target client, click Configure, and the package writes the recommended MCP config entry for you.
For Claude Code, Cursor, and Codex, click Configure + Skills to also install the default project MCP workflow skill.
If you want project-specific AI guidance for the current Unity project, open Funplay โ Project Skills to choose supported platforms and install the default unity-mcp-workflow skill.

It lets an AI write a C# snippet, compile it through a Roslyn-first in-memory flow, and run it on the editor thread โ the agent gets the full Unity Editor and runtime API surface without writing any project files to disk.
.cs files are written under Assets/, no domain reload is triggered, no project state is touched beyond what the snippet itself does.request_recompile.IFunplayCommand and use the injected ExecutionContext so every created / modified / destroyed object participates in editor Undo, and the changelog is returned to the agent.The response carries { logs, created, modified, destroyed, returnValue }, so the agent can verify exactly what changed without re-querying the scene.
The legacy template (public static string Run()) is still supported โ useful for one-off inspection snippets where structured tracking is overkill.
When to reach for execute_code vs a specialized tool โ execute_code shines for multi-step orchestration, novel reads, and situations where chaining 5โ10 narrow tool calls would be noisier than one snippet. For single-field component edits, simple selection changes, or anything covered by an existing tool, prefer the dedicated tool โ it is cheaper for the LLM to call and easier to verify.
The table below compares this repository with the publicly documented behavior of Coplay's open-source unity-mcp repository on GitHub.
| Area | Funplay MCP for Unity | Coplay unity-mcp |
|---|---|---|
| Unity-side architecture | Embedded Unity Editor package with built-in HTTP MCP server | Unity bridge plus local Python MCP server |
| Extra local prerequisites | Unity package only for core workflows | Unity + Python 3.10+ + uv according to the public quick start |
| Primary workflow style | execute_code first, then focused helper tools | Broad manage_* tool families exposed through the bridge |
| Default tool exposure | Compact core profile with optional full expansion | Public docs emphasize a broad always-available tool surface |
| Built-in context model | Project resources, resource templates, workflow prompts, interaction history | Public README emphasizes tool families and bridge/server workflow |
| Play mode validation | Built-in play mode control, screenshots, logs, and input simulation in the package | Public README emphasizes broad Unity management and automation tools |
| Positioning | Lightweight, direct, MIT-licensed Unity MCP server for AI-driven editor control | Full-featured Unity bridge maintained by Coplay with Python-backed server setup |
Source for Coplay column: CoplayDev/unity-mcp
The table below compares this repository with Unity Technologies' official com.unity.ai.assistant package (v2.7.0-pre.2 as of 2026-05).
| Area | Funplay MCP for Unity | Unity AI Assistant |
|---|---|---|
| Minimum Unity version | 2022.3 | 6000.3 (Unity 6 only) |
| License | MIT, open source | Unity Terms of Service, proprietary |
| Deployment | Local HTTP MCP server in Editor, no cloud | Editor + native Relay subprocess + Unity Cloud backend |
| Billing | Free, user brings their own AI client | Credits-based (Unity Dashboard) |
| Tool exposure | 156 tools across 35 modules, core (34) / full profiles | ~15 MCP tools (mostly Manage* families) |
| Generic escape hatch | execute_code โ Roslyn-first in-memory compile, IFunplayCommand + Undo, no sandbox (client-side approval) | RunCommand โ namespace blacklist sandbox |
| Play mode validation | Full loop: enter / simulate input / capture / read logs / exit | Enter/Exit only; no input simulation |
| Asset generators | Not built-in (compose external APIs via execute_code) | Native Image / Mesh / PBR / Sound / Animation generators |
| Primary client model | BYO any MCP client (Claude Code / Cursor / LM Studio / Codex / VS Code) | Built-in chat window + ACP for Claude/Gemini via Gateway |
| Offline-capable | Yes for tool calls (inference depends on chosen client) | No (inference requires Unity Cloud) |

Funplay MCP for Unity currently ships with 156 tool functions across 35 modules:
| Category | Tools |
|---|---|
| GameObject | create_primitive, create_game_object, delete_game_object, find_game_objects, get_game_object_info, set_transform, duplicate_game_object, rename_game_object, set_parent, add_component, set_tag_and_layer, set_active |
| Hierarchy | get_hierarchy |
| Components | get_component_properties, list_components, set_component_property, set_component_properties |
| Component Batch | copy_component, paste_component_values, add_component_to_many |
| Scripts | create_script, edit_script, patch_script |
| Assets | create_material, assign_material, find_assets, delete_asset, rename_asset, copy_asset |
| Asset Import | get_asset_import_settings, set_asset_import_settings |
| References | find_references, find_broken_references |
| Mesh | get_mesh_info |
| Materials | get_material_properties, set_material_property |
| Files | read_file, write_file, search_files, list_directory, exists |
| Scene | get_scene_info, list_scenes, load_scene_additive, unload_scene, list_dirty_scenes, save_all_scenes, save_scene, open_scene, create_new_scene, enter_play_mode, exit_play_mode, set_time_scale, get_time_scale |
| Physics | physics_raycast, physics_overlap, physics2d_overlap_point |
| Particles | particle_control |
| Lighting | get_lighting_settings, set_lighting_settings, bake_lightmaps |
| Timeline | director_evaluate |
| Prefabs | create_prefab, instantiate_prefab, unpack_prefab, open_prefab_stage, save_prefab_stage, close_prefab_stage, set_prefab_property, set_prefab_properties |
| ScriptableObject | create_scriptable_object, get_scriptable_object, set_scriptable_object_properties |
| UI | create_canvas, create_button, create_text, create_image, raycast_at_point |
| Animation | create_animation_clip, create_animator_controller, assign_animator, get_animator_state, set_animator_parameter, play_animator_state |
| Camera | get_camera_properties, set_camera_projection, set_camera_settings, set_camera_culling_mask |
| Screenshot | capture_game_view, capture_simulator_view, capture_scene_view, capture_multiview, capture_editor_window |
| Script Execution | execute_code, get_execute_code_history, replay_execute_code, clear_execute_code_history |
| Input Simulation | simulate_key_press, simulate_key_combo, simulate_mouse_click, simulate_mouse_drag |
| Performance | get_performance_snapshot, analyze_scene_complexity |
| Profiler | profiler_start, profiler_stop, profiler_status, get_frame_timing, get_counters, get_object_memory, get_top_memory_objects, memory_take_snapshot, memory_list_snapshots, memory_compare_snapshots, frame_debugger_enable, frame_debugger_disable, frame_debugger_get_events |
| Memory Snapshot | memory_take_full_snapshot, memory_list_full_snapshots, memory_open_snapshot_in_profiler, memory_query_top_objects, memory_query_references |
| Packages | install_package, remove_package, list_packages |
| Compilation | wait_for_compilation, request_recompile, get_compilation_errors, get_reload_recovery_status |
| Testing | run_tests, get_test_job, cancel_test_run |
| Editor State | get_editor_state, get_selection, set_selection, get_prefab_stage, get_active_tool, set_active_tool, get_windows, get_tags, add_tag, remove_tag, get_layers, add_layer, get_build_settings |
| Project Settings | get_project_settings |
| Undo | undo, redo, get_undo_state |
| Menu Items | execute_menu_item, validate_menu_item |
| Visual Feedback | select_object, focus_on_object, ping_asset, log_message, show_dialog, get_console_logs |

Create your own tools with simple attribute annotations:
Methods are automatically discovered, converted to snake_case (spawn_enemies), and exposed via MCP with JSON Schema definitions.
